Part Nine:
Our Testimony

W e - my wife, Ruth, and I - have seen the power of the words clearly at work in our own lives.

In 1991 inspired preaching caused us to see that God wanted to bless us financially just as He had already done in so many other areas of our lives.

We brought this to Him in prayer, asking to be blessed as He desired to bless us. We believed we received when we prayed. We counted it done. We walked on from there believing we had received. (Mark 11:24.)

Besides this we continued to diligently tithe and we started to give like a farmer sows a seed. However, months passed and nothing seemed to come up - no harvest, no physical manifestation of financial increase in our lives.

I took this to the Lord in prayer and asked Him why we weren't yet seeing increase. His reply came very simply and very gently. He said, "What about all the times you say to people, We can't afford it! This is what you are saying in the Earth while in Heaven you are saying, My God shall supply all my need according to His riches in glory by Christ Jesus." Phillipians 4:19.

I received correction! I prayed, "Forgive me, Lord. From this moment forwards I will not say again, We can't afford it. Teach me to line up everything I say with the Truth."

This was the turning point in our lives financially. I began to make my words agree with God's Word and with what I had prayed for in faith. It was not long after this that Ruth and I saw our material affairs beginning to prosper.

What are you doing about your words? Think about it! Do you speak words that contradict God's Word or agree with it? Is your tongue directing the course of your life on a heading towards having or away from it?

If you've prayed in faith for freedom from fear, check you're not still saying, "I'm afraid." If you've prayed in faith for healing, check you're not still saying, "I have this sickness."
